1. | Lillian Fairbanks was born about 1886 in Easky, County Sligo, Province of Connacht, Ireland, United Kingdom; died on 27 Nov 1971 in Laidley, Lockyer Valley Region, Queensland, Australia; was buried on 29 Nov 1971 in Helidon General Cemetery, Helidon, Lockyer Valley Region, Queensland, Australia. Other Events and Attributes:
- Also Known As: Mary J Fairbanks
- Occupation: Nurse
- Cause of Death: Coronary occlusion, atherosclerosis
- Emigration: 30 Jun 1888, London, England, United Kingdom
- Immigration: 17 Aug 1888, Brisbane, Colony of Queensland
- Residence: Mar 1913, Toowoomba, Toowomba District, Darling Downs Region, Queensland, Australia
Notes:
In source [QSA-1888a], the second eldest daughter John Edward and Elizabeth (Lush) Fairbanks, is listed as “Mary J”. However every other available record from the birth records of all her Australian born siblings, to her marriage certificate, and including the death records for both of her parents, record this woman’s name as “Lillian”—which appears to the name she used throughout her life.
